The correlation between historical prices or returns on Large Cap Growth and Msvif Emerging is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Msvif Emerging Mkts are associated (or correlated) with Large Cap.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Large Cap Growth has no effect on the direction of Msvif Emerging i.e., Msvif Emerging and Large Cap go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Msvif Emerging and Large Cap

The main advantage of trading using opposite Msvif Emerging and Large Cap posit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Msvif Emerging position performs unexpectedly, Large Cap can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Large Cap will offset losses from the drop in Large Cap's long position.
The idea behind Msvif Emerging Mkts and Large Cap Growth Profund p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side). This can be achieved by designing a pairs trade with two highly correlated stocks or equities that operate in a similar space or sector, making it possible to obtain profits through simple and relatively low-risk investment.
